Reconstruction Of Silk Road With Remote Sensing And Ancient Maps And Its Analysis Of Geographical Characteristics

As an ancient east-west traffic artery,the ancient Silk Road is one of the most important trade lines in human history,leaving a large number of ancient cities,urns,cultural relics and historic sites,etc.,which has great academic research value.With the implementation and promotion of China's “One Belt,One Road” strategy,a deep understanding of the evolution history of the ancient Silk Road and its systematic research are also historical reflections on the relationship between man and land,natural environment and urban settlement along the ancient Silk Road.It is conducive to promoting economic cooperation between China and Central Asia,and providing basic support and decision-making basis for China to expand the Central Asian market and enhancing regional cooperation and development,and to lay a theoretical foundation for better building a new Silk Road economic belt..As the starting point of the northern road of the Desert Silk Road and the border town,Guazhou plays an important role in maintaining the economic relationship between the east and the west.The article takes the ancient road of Guazhou section of the ancient Silk Road as the research object,and studies two aspects: First,confirm the information along the line according to remote sensing image data,related literature data and field investigation data,and select the eastern part of the study area as the site extraction test.District,supervise and classify the study area and the test area,select the ratio of the perimeter of the map and the square root of the area to calculate the shape index of the ancient site,and combine the spectral feature classification results of the image to extract the information from the ancient site and interpret the ancient The distribution of the site,using the GIS method to map the ancient road route of the Guazhou section of the Silk Road with the ancient map as the base and the remote sensing image;the second is to analyze the geographical features of the restored ancient road,and select the slope,elevation,water system,etc.as the impact factor.The geographical characteristics of the Silk Road in the Guazhou section are analyzed by the gradient classification,the elevation profile,the remote sensing information and the DEM data.The geographical characteristics of the Guazhou section of the Silk Road are analyzed,and the heat transfer and heat transfer are based on the characteristics of the soil transformation to the consolidation soil.Based on poor permeability,the single-window algorithm is used to invert the temperature of the study area.Got the following results:1.The information extraction of ancient sites based on shape index is realized.The results show that the shape index of the map markers for construction is larger than the shape index of other maps,and the shape index of the map markers for construction is defined as the threshold of the shape index of other land types,and the maps of similar shapes are screened out.Reduce the number and scope of extraction of target sites,and improve the accuracy of the extraction of ancient sites and the efficiency of visual interpretation.2.Analyze the geographical features along the ancient road and verify that the restoration of the ancient road is accurate.The study area is located in the Hexi Corridor,a north-south long stripup plain,with most of the slopes undulating.By grading the slope of the ancient road,the results show that 70% of the slope is less than 5°,86% of the slope is less than 15°,and the slope of the restored ancient road is small;the stations along the line are mostly distributed at an altitude of 1100m~1300m,and the terrain is less undulating.The line is relatively flat.The water system in the study area was extracted by the combination of remote sensing information and DEM data.The results show that the distribution of the ancient station and the water system has a spatial relationship.3.The inversion of the temperature of the study area based on the single window algorithm is realized.The results show that under the condition of rising temperature in the study area,the surface temperature of the ancient road is lower than that of other areas in the study area,which is in line with the experimental expectation,which further confirms that the ancient road extraction is more accurate.Confirm that the article repainted the Silk Road Guazhou section in line with the historical trend.
